Finalist: BuzzFeed News and the International Consortium of Investigative Journalists, Washington, D.C.

For a massive reporting project that yielded sweeping revelations about the ongoing role of some of the world’s biggest banks in facilitating international money laundering and the trafficking of goods and people, corruption that continues to frustrate regulators across the world.
